Keratinocytes directly control epithelial retention of

leukocytes via a novel mechanism of intercellular

communication

• LC migration is cell extrinsic (i.e. Keratinocytes

determine LC migration)

• Avβ6 and Avβ8 are spatially distinct and regulated

• DC and T cell retention varies by epidermal anatomy

and could be differently regulated

• Targeting TGFβ or its activation could be used to deplete

TRM from epidermis (e.g. Alopecia Areata, Psoriasis,

CTCL, Vitiligo)
